Mark your calendars! A truly spectacular celestial event is heading our way on March 13-14, 2025—a total lunar eclipse, also known as the "Blood Moon." After a long wait, this will be the first lunar eclipse visible from Earth since 2022, and it’s going to be a sight to remember. The moon will be bathed in a rich red tint for almost 65 minutes, producing a spectacular display guaranteed to astound everyone. Although the Pacific Ocean will host the biggest eclipse, there are many locations all around the globe where one may get a close-up view of this amazing event.

1. Los Angeles, United States—West Coast
Thanks to its clear skies and minimal light pollution, Los Angeles is a great place to see the Blood Moon. Whether you're viewing the eclipse from the city itself or from the surrounding hills, the West Coast offers some of the best conditions for the event, ensuring you have a remarkable experience.
2. Mexico (Mazatlán and Puerto Vallarta)
With locations like Puerto Vallarta and Mazatlán offering stunning coastal views, Mexico's Pacific coast is an excellent destination to witness the lunar eclipse. Imagine watching the Blood Moon rise against the ocean—it's truly a dream come true for skywatchers.
3. Mendoza, Argentina
Mendoza, located in the heart of Argentina's wine region, is an ideal spot for stargazing due to its clear skies and peaceful surroundings. The flat, dry terrain ensures an unobstructed view of the Blood Moon, making it the perfect place to witness this rare celestial event.
4. Chile's Atacama Desert
Renowned worldwide for its pure air and cloudless skies, the Atacama Desert offers some of the best stargazing conditions on Earth. The high altitude and low light pollution make it one of the top locations to view the lunar eclipse in March 2025.
5. Madrid, Spain
Madrid offers excellent viewing conditions for the lunar eclipse, especially from the western part of the city. While Europe will only see a partial view of the moonset, Madrid provides a fantastic vantage point to experience the spectacle framed by the city’s stunning architecture.
6. Lisbon, Portugal
Lisbon, located on Europe’s western coast, provides a breathtaking view of the Blood Moon, particularly at moonset. With its mild March weather and coastal setting, Lisbon is the perfect destination for those wishing to witness this celestial wonder.
